Sr. Manager - Labor Relations and HR Compliance

Job Description:

RESPONSIBILITIES 

1. Labor Law Compliance & Governance

Ensure full compliance with all applicable labor laws including:

  • Shops & Establishments Acts (state-specific)
  • Factories Act (where applicable)
  • CLRA (Contract Labour Regulation & Abolition Act)
  • Industrial Disputes Act
  • Statutory legislations (PF, ESI, Gratuity, Bonus, etc.)
  • Lead periodic compliance audits (internal & external) and drive closure of observations
  • Establish robust compliance dashboards and trackers with 100% statutory adherence
  • Ensure timely filings, returns, and maintenance of registers (digital & physical as applicable)

    2. New Wage Code Implementation

  • Lead end-to-end implementation of the New Wage Codes (2025) across all entities
  • Redesign compensation structures in alignment with definition of wages
  • Impact on PF, Gratuity, Bonus, Overtime
  • Partner with Finance, Payroll, and Legal to ensure seamless rollout
  • Drive updates to all HR policies, SOPs, and employment contracts
  • Conduct impact analysis and risk mitigation for cost, compliance, and employee experience

    3. Policy Formulation & Compliance Framework

  • Design, review, and update HR policies in line with evolving labor regulations
  • Build standardized SOPs, control frameworks, and governance models
  • Ensure policy alignment with global standards while maintaining India statutory compliance
  • Lead implementation of maker-checker-approver controls for critical HR processes (SOX aligned)

    4. Industrial Relations & Union Management

  • Manage relationships with trade unions and worker representatives
  • Lead collective bargaining processes, wage settlements, and negotiations
  • Ensure proactive grievance handling and dispute resolution mechanisms
  • Support plant/site leadership in maintaining a stable IR environment
  • Represent the organization in conciliation proceedings and labor authorities, where required

    5. Contract Labor & CLRA Compliance

  • Ensure compliance with CLRA provisions including:
    • Contractor licensing and registration
    • Wage payments and statutory benefits for contract workers
  • Conduct regular contractor compliance audits
  • Implement systems for principal employer liability tracking and mitigation
  • Drive digitization of contractor compliance records and documentation

    6. Customer & Statutory Compliance

  • Ensure adherence to customer-specific compliance requirements, especially for:
  • Audits (client, statutory, third-party)
  • Vendor and site compliance certifications
  • Act as the central SPOC for compliance documentation and audit readiness
  • Maintain zero non-compliance stance for customer-facing operations

    7. Risk Management & Compliance Transformation

  • Identify compliance risks and implement preventive controls
  • Drive automation and digitalization of compliance processes (Oracle HCM / dashboards / RPA)
  • Strengthen data governance, documentation, and audit trails
  • Embed a culture of “compliance by design” across HR and operations

Key Deliverables (Success Metrics)

  • 100% compliance with statutory laws and zero major audit observations
  • Successful implementation of New Wage Codes with no compliance gaps
  • Stable industrial relations environment with minimal disputes/escalations
  • 100% contractor compliance under CLRA
  • Audit readiness for all customer and statutory audits
  • Digitized compliance dashboards with real-time tracking
